ST. THOMAS AQUINAS COLLEGE ANNOUNCES NEW ASSISTANT DIRECTOR OF CORPORATE AND FOUNDATION RELATIONS

Rhonda VanAntwerp was recently appointed as the new assistant director of corporate and foundation relations at St. Thomas Aquinas College, announced Karen Wright, vice president for institutional advancement at the college. As assistant director of corporate and foundation relations, VanAntwerp is responsible for the identification, cultivation, solicitation, and stewardship of private foundations and corporate grants […]

Rockland County Sports Hall of Fame Announces Nine Inductees

The Rockland County Sports Hall of Fame announced its 45th annual induction class this week. The new members of Rockland sports royalty are: – Phil Bogle, football star from Spring Valley High School – Thomas Dickson, multisport standout from Clarkstown North (posthumous) – Bobby Lawson, football star from Clarkstown North, former NFL player – Chuck […]

Explore New York Spending and Taxes with Budget App

The Empire Center’s unique online “Explore Your State Budget” app has been updated to reflect data in Gov. Andrew Cuomo’s proposed Executive Budget for the 2019 fiscal year, which begins April 1. The database of New York state budget information at SeeThroughNY.net includes actual results, estimates and projections for major spending and tax categories from […]
